WebJul 21, 2024 · HB 1194 Changes to Shelter Care Provisions (RCW 13.34.065) Mandates regular and liberal parent-child and sibling visits in shelter care. The court shall order a visitation plan that is individualized to the needs of the family with the goal of providing the maximum parent, child and sibling contact possible. WebDSS Ready by 21 Unit. WebMar 30, 2005 · "`Shelter care' means temporary physical care in a facility licensed pursuant to RCW 74.15.030or in a home not required to be licensed pursuant to RCW 74.15.030." RCW 13.34.030(13). ¶8 The GAL opposed an in-home placement for the children because the petitions alleged extraordinary abuse and neglect. WebThe primary purpose of the shelter care hearing is to determine whether the child can be immediately and safely returned home while the adjudication of the dependency is …
